One of the hall marks of how we live is that we actually see very little of people moving about outside their triple tilt-a-door and remotely controlled garages and SUV cars, or busying themselves in their neighbourhoods.
It got me beat that so many of us insist on gardens and space when we rarely are moving about in those gardens. During daytime it is a rare event indeed to see people outside, chatting or congregating together.
We must, of course have outside barbecues, but a recent survey has shown that Australians actually do very little of that barbecuing compared with other countries. We are just too busy or spend too much time travelling between those huge open and desolate spaces to get to and from work, or childcare centres, or shopping centres,.
